作者kumusou ()
看板PHP
標題[請益] 關於string
時間Mon Nov 22 23:04:10 2010
我希望在一個string中計算英文單字數目
ex. "The day is not my day." -> count is 6
我目前的想法是用substr_count($str, " ");
不過為什麼他會把每個char都算一次呢?
還是php還有甚麼function 在計算這種的嗎?
感謝各位先進~
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 118.166.251.54
1F:推 mesak:$arr=explode(' ',$str);echo count($arr); 11/22 23:16
2F:→ kumusou:結果還是一樣耶QQ 我在想是不是DB跟網頁都是UTF8 11/22 23:40
3F:→ kumusou:而我是在NOTEPAD++ ASCI CODE編碼 所以造成" "讀錯? 11/22 23:41
4F:→ kumusou:已經解決 謝謝一樓 ^___^ 11/23 00:18